The History of the Female Prisoner Costume

The female prisoner costume is a unique and recognizable look that has been around for decades. It is often associated with Halloween festivities, but the history of this iconic style actually dates back much further.

Originally worn in the mid-19th century by women who were convicted of petty crimes, such as theft or shoplifting, the classic female prisoner costume consisted of a loose-fitting striped dress and cap. The uniform was designed to be unappealing and unattractive, both so it could easily identify prisoners while they were serving their sentence and also to discourage others from committing similar offences. As prison uniforms became more fashionable over time, though still maintaining its unmistakable design elements like stripes and an inmate number patch on the chest area, these garments eventually made their way into popular culture as a fashion statement–albeit one with strong connotations attached to it.
